As Ontario’s Authorized Inspection Agency (AIA) recognized by the Canadian Nuclear Safety Commission (CNSC), TSSA plays a critical role in ensuring the safety and reliability of nuclear pressure equipment. Our work spans engineering reviews, inspections, and quality audits—while actively contributing to standards development and supporting innovation in the nuclear sector.
TSSA works closely with nuclear utilities and component suppliers to ensure that safety standards are met and maintained. Alongside its regulatory role, TSSA supports the modernization of nuclear design, construction, operations, and life extension by evaluating and integrating emerging technologies. The agency contributes to the development of coordinated, outcome-based regulatory approaches, and it shares its expertise by providing training and advisory support—primarily in Ontario, but also to new and developing jurisdictions when needed.
Boiler and Pressure Vessel (BPV) Regulations at Nuclear Plants
The safety and reliability of nuclear power plants depend on rigorous standards for design, manufacturing, inspection, and maintenance. Ontario adheres to internationally recognized standards developed by CSA Group, the National Board of Boiler and Pressure Vessel Inspectors (NBBI), the American Society of Mechanical Engineers (ASME), and other applicable standards.
Compliance with these standards ensures the long-term integrity of nuclear infrastructure and safe delivery of clean energy.
TSSA’s Role in Nuclear Safety
Certified by NBBI and ASME, TSSA works closely with nuclear generating stations and component suppliers to perform:
Engineering Review & Registration
- Review and register nuclear component designs and welding/brazing procedures for compliance with national codes.
Quality Auditing & Certifications
- Verify personnel training, process controls, and code compliance before certification.
- Certify suppliers and utilities as Certificate Holders.
- Audit quality programs for manufacturers and repair organizations.
Inspection & Monitoring
- Oversee manufacturing activities of certified suppliers.
- Verify repairs and alterations, witness pressure tests, and conduct periodic inspections.
Contribution to Standards Development
TSSA actively participates in CSA and ASME committees, helping advance standards and integrate emerging technologies for safe nuclear innovation.
